Well, Actually: Your Five-Dollar AI Empire Comes with 13 Fine-Print Surprises

A product called AI Side Hustle Videos sells 50 PLR videos for $5 at launch, then immediately presents buyers with 13 one-time offers. The package grants private label rights, meaning purchasers can rebrand and resell the content. The review notes refund claims exist alongside the standard pros and cons of such arrangements.

This illustrates the classic digital marketing funnel: loss-leader pricing to capture attention, followed by successive upsells that represent the actual revenue model. You should examine the total cost of ownership before committing to any "cheap" AI product. The principle applies to evaluating any tool with tiered pricing: map the full price stack, not merely the entry point.

The product is reviewed by Digital Product Review, which catalogs the 50 videos, 13 OTOs, and rights structure. The original vendor is not named in the source material. No specific revenue figures for buyers are provided.

Step 1: Search for any AI product you are considering and add "review" plus "OTO" or "upsell" to your query. Read three independent reviews to map the complete pricing structure before purchase. Expected outcome: you will know the true cost before clicking buy. Step 2: Read the PLR or resale rights terms yourself, not merely the marketing summary. Expected outcome: you will understand what you can legally do with the content. Step 3: Calculate your break-even point: how many units must you resell to recover your total investment including all OTOs. Expected outcome: a rational basis for your purchase decision.
